aboutsummaryrefslogtreecommitdiff
path: root/core
diff options
context:
space:
mode:
Diffstat (limited to 'core')
-rw-r--r--core/src/main/kotlin/pages/DocTagToContentConverter.kt22
1 files changed, 20 insertions, 2 deletions
diff --git a/core/src/main/kotlin/pages/DocTagToContentConverter.kt b/core/src/main/kotlin/pages/DocTagToContentConverter.kt
index da19765e..3d34ddd2 100644
--- a/core/src/main/kotlin/pages/DocTagToContentConverter.kt
+++ b/core/src/main/kotlin/pages/DocTagToContentConverter.kt
@@ -59,7 +59,16 @@ class DocTagToContentConverter(
extras
)
)
- is BlockQuote -> TODO("Implement DocNotToContent BlockQuote!")
+ is BlockQuote -> listOf(
+ ContentCode(
+ buildChildren(docTag),
+ "",
+ dci,
+ platforms,
+ styles,
+ extras
+ )
+ )
is Code -> listOf(
ContentCode(
buildChildren(docTag),
@@ -70,7 +79,16 @@ class DocTagToContentConverter(
extras
)
)
- is Img -> TODO("Implement DocNotToContent Img!")
+ is Img -> listOf(
+ ContentEmbeddedResource(
+ address = docTag.params.get("href")!!,
+ altText = docTag.params.get("alt"),
+ dci = dci,
+ platforms = platforms,
+ style = styles,
+ extras = extras
+ )
+ )
is HorizontalRule -> listOf(ContentText("", dci, platforms, setOf()))
is Text -> listOf(ContentText(docTag.body, dci, platforms, styles, extras))
else -> buildChildren(docTag)